Look for the Anti-Drug Super Bowl Ads

Saturday February 2, 2008
The Office of National Drug Control Policy, ONDCP, has launched a campaign to educate parents about teen prescription drug abuse. They are starting off this weekend with two different Super Bowl ads that you can use as ice breakers for talks with your teen. Here are a few fast facts about teen prescription drug abuse:
  • More teens abuse prescription drugs than any illicit drug except marijuana.
  • In 2006, more than 2.1 million teens ages 12 to 17 reported abusing prescription drugs.
  • Among 12- and 13-year-olds, prescription drugs are the drug of choice.
